POPE, Presiding Judge.

Defendant was convicted by a jury of reckless conduct, a misdemeanor. See OCGA § 16-5-60(b). In two enumerations of error, he challenges the sufficiency of the evidence against him. Specifically, he argues that his conduct constituted either simple negligence or intentional assault, but could not be considered reckless. We disagree and affirm.
